Re: Como fazer roteamento
veja a situação de uma cliente meu que tem varias conexoes ...
servidor linux (gateway)
eth0: 200.0.0.2 (internet)
eth1: 143.0.0.2 (rnp.br)
eth2: 201.0.0.2 (rnp.br 2)
eth3: 10.0.0.1 (intranet)
router internet: 200.0.0.1 (ligado na eth0 do gateway) * rota padrao
router rnp.br: 143.0.0.1 (uma porta do router vai na eth1 e outra vai na eth2)
a eth3 esta ligada no switch da rede
nas estacoes a configuração fica assim:
ip: 10.0.0.X
gw: 10.0.0.1
as rotas no servidor:
route add -net 143.0.0.0 netmask 255.255.255.0 gw 143.0.0.1 dev eth1
route add -net 201.0.0.0 netmask 255.255.255.0 gw 201.0.0.1 dev eth2
route add default gw 200.0.0.1
todo trafego que nao for pra rede 143.0.0.0/24 e 201.0.0.0/24 sai pelo gw padrao..
Re: Como fazer roteamento
Citação:
Postado originalmente por Alexandre Correa
veja a situação de uma cliente meu que tem varias conexoes ...
servidor linux (gateway)
eth0: 200.0.0.2 (internet)
eth1: 143.0.0.2 (rnp.br)
eth2: 201.0.0.2 (rnp.br 2)
eth3: 10.0.0.1 (intranet)
router internet: 200.0.0.1 (ligado na eth0 do gateway) * rota padrao
router rnp.br: 143.0.0.1 (uma porta do router vai na eth1 e outra vai na eth2)
a eth3 esta ligada no switch da rede
nas estacoes a configuração fica assim:
ip: 10.0.0.X
gw: 10.0.0.1
as rotas no servidor:
route add -net 143.0.0.0 netmask 255.255.255.0 gw 143.0.0.1 dev eth1
route add -net 201.0.0.0 netmask 255.255.255.0 gw 201.0.0.1 dev eth2
route add default gw 200.0.0.1
todo trafego que nao for pra rede 143.0.0.0/24 e 201.0.0.0/24 sai pelo gw padrao..
Galera e isso q naum estou entendendo, pq o roteador da outra cidade esta ligado pelo modem da telemar no mesmo roteador do meu Link principal, se tivesse ligado em um outro roteador ligado a outra placa de rede tudo bem, mais desse geito que esta naum intendo como posso sair pra rede 192.168.1.0 pela mesma eth0 e mesmo roteador?
Lembrando que o Link da cidade de la com me provedor naum e IPCONECT e um tal de TCDATA.
Re: Como fazer roteamento
Prrezado amigo, pelo q deu a entender vc tem um pr2000 (tem duas seriais v.35) o qual uma delas ta ligado o link internet (200.223.252.253) e a outra esta ligado seu link filial (192.168.1.0).
sua rede na filial tem q ficar 192.168.1.0/255.255.255.0 e gatway 192.168.1.1.
O roteador pr2000 tem duas interfaces serias e uma lan entao o q vc tem q fazer eh:
no roteador criar uma lan virtual no roteador ex: 192.168.2.1/255.255.255.0
criar uma rota dizendo que tudo q vier da seral (link filial) va para lan (ip Virtual 192.168.2.1) e outra indicando que o q vier da lan va para a serial do link internet.
(se naum souber peca a alguem q saiba configurar o pr2000)
alterar sua rede interna eth2 para a mascara 255.255.255.0 e para nao ter q conectar o roteador direto no seu hub , pode ser feito o seguinte: criar um apelido de ip para maquina virtual no conectiva na interface eth0 com o ip 192.168.2.2/255.255.255.0.
agora vc deve ter o seguinte:
eth0 = 200.223.252.253
eth0:0 = 192.168.2.2 / 255.255.255.0
eth2 = 192.168.0.200 / 255.255.255.0
entao agora vc cria a rota no linux para ver a outra rede
route add -net 192.168.1.0 netmask 255.255.255.0 gw 192.168.2.2 (coloca isso no /etc/rc.d/rc.local).
no seu firewall nao sei como ta se pudesse ver seria melhor acho que nao deve alterar nada.
mas acho que vai funcionar pois antes vc tava usando a mascara 255.255.248.0 que te da um range de 6 redes tipo 192.168.(0-6).X
ja fiz algumas redes desse tipo . a configuraçao principal tem que ser no roteador que ta os links.
Re: Como fazer roteamento
Citação:
Postado originalmente por csjunior
Prrezado amigo, pelo q deu a entender vc tem um pr2000 (tem duas seriais v.35) o qual uma delas ta ligado o link internet (200.223.252.253) e a outra esta ligado seu link filial (192.168.1.0).
sua rede na filial tem q ficar 192.168.1.0/255.255.255.0 e gatway 192.168.1.1.
O roteador pr2000 tem duas interfaces serias e uma lan entao o q vc tem q fazer eh:
no roteador criar uma lan virtual no roteador ex: 192.168.2.1/255.255.255.0
criar uma rota dizendo que tudo q vier da seral (link filial) va para lan (ip Virtual 192.168.2.1) e outra indicando que o q vier da lan va para a serial do link internet.
(se naum souber peca a alguem q saiba configurar o pr2000)
alterar sua rede interna eth2 para a mascara 255.255.255.0 e para nao ter q conectar o roteador direto no seu hub , pode ser feito o seguinte: criar um apelido de ip para maquina virtual no conectiva na interface eth0 com o ip 192.168.2.2/255.255.255.0.
agora vc deve ter o seguinte:
eth0 = 200.223.252.253
eth0:0 = 192.168.2.2 / 255.255.255.0
eth2 = 192.168.0.200 / 255.255.255.0
entao agora vc cria a rota no linux para ver a outra rede
route add -net 192.168.1.0 netmask 255.255.255.0 gw 192.168.2.2 (coloca isso no /etc/rc.d/rc.local).
no seu firewall nao sei como ta se pudesse ver seria melhor acho que nao deve alterar nada.
mas acho que vai funcionar pois antes vc tava usando a mascara 255.255.248.0 que te da um range de 6 redes tipo 192.168.(0-6).X
ja fiz algumas redes desse tipo . a configuraçao principal tem que ser no roteador que ta os links.
Entaum o cara da telemar e que ta errando pq no roteador ele fez 10.0.0.1 255.0.0.0
e disse que eu teria que por um ip real na etho junto o outro que ta la apontando pro do roteador 10.0.0.1 255.0.0.0, Estou correto que o erro e dele? Acredito q se eu fizer como vc falou vai dar certo.